How they compare

Romania currently reports 198,247 against 192,144 in New Zealand, a difference of 6,103.

Across all 273 years both countries report, Romania has been ahead every year.

New Zealand ranks 70th and Romania ranks 68th of 220 countries.

Romania has averaged higher in every one of the 28 decades both report.
